Overview: Dubrovnik to Glasgow flight
Flights from Dubrovnik to Glasgow depart on average 5 times per day, taking around 9h 20m. Cheap flight tickets for this journey start at $171 (€137) if you book in advance.
The earliest flight runs at 01:00, the last at 22:05. The fastest flight covers the 1348 miles (2171 km) distance in 5h 5m. May is the cheapest month to fly.

Typically, passengers are allowed one carry-on bag and one personal item (for example a purse, laptop bag, or backpack). Personal items must fit under the seat in front of you.
Budget Airlines (like Ryanair or Wizz Air) have stricter size and weight limits, often requiring fees for larger carry-ons. Full-Service Airlines have more lenient policies, sometimes including more spacious dimensions or higher weight limits depending on your ticket class.
